Output 81568bf253dea3f1ec503045354124e806d7a3561f026d8dc8aa97c2fae15d07:1

value
4543207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e7557232ba3abc2de91a7b68b6d0f3450d6267 OP_EQUAL
address
33WFtYKuMAx9SyyHrY1TP8TByt2EVe6E2z
transaction
81568bf253dea3f1ec503045354124e806d7a3561f026d8dc8aa97c2fae15d07
spent
true